RedHat 9.0 via yum aktuell halten
Aus BraLUG-Wiki
K |
MaD (Diskussion | Beiträge) K (etwas verschönert, Kategorie geändert....) |
||
Zeile 1: | Zeile 1: | ||
− | [[Category: | + | [[Category:Tipps und Tricks]] |
[[Category:Distributionen]] | [[Category:Distributionen]] | ||
− | |||
yum stammt eigentlich aus der Ferdora-Distribution, kann aber auch zur Aktualisierung einer RedHat-Installation verwendet werden. In der Folge ist eine Kurzanleitung für RedHat zu finden. Eine ausführliche Dokumentation ist unter http://www.fedoralegacy.org (auch für andere RedHat-Versionen) zu finden. | yum stammt eigentlich aus der Ferdora-Distribution, kann aber auch zur Aktualisierung einer RedHat-Installation verwendet werden. In der Folge ist eine Kurzanleitung für RedHat zu finden. Eine ausführliche Dokumentation ist unter http://www.fedoralegacy.org (auch für andere RedHat-Versionen) zu finden. | ||
Zeile 10: | Zeile 9: | ||
* aktuelles gnupg installieren | * aktuelles gnupg installieren | ||
− | + | rpm -Uvh http://download.fedoralegacy.org/redhat/9/updates/i386/gnupg-1.2.1-9.i386.rpm | |
− | rpm -Uvh http://download.fedoralegacy.org/redhat/9/updates/i386/gnupg-1.2.1-9.i386.rpm | + | |
− | + | ||
* yum installieren | * yum installieren | ||
− | rpm -ivh http://download.fedora.us/fedora/redhat/9/i386/RPMS.stable/yum-2.0.3-0.fdr.1.rh90.noarch.rpm | + | rpm -ivh http://download.fedora.us/fedora/redhat/9/i386/RPMS.stable/yum-2.0.3-0.fdr.1.rh90.noarch.rpm |
Zeile 22: | Zeile 19: | ||
In /etc/yum.conf sollte stehen: | In /etc/yum.conf sollte stehen: | ||
− | [main] | + | [main] |
− | + | cachedir=/var/cache/yum | |
− | cachedir=/var/cache/yum | + | debuglevel=2 |
− | + | logfile=/var/log/yum.log | |
− | debuglevel=2 | + | pkgpolicy=newest |
− | + | distroverpkg=redhat-release | |
− | logfile=/var/log/yum.log | + | tolerant=1 |
− | + | exactarch=1 | |
− | pkgpolicy=newest | + | exclude=kernel* |
− | + | ||
− | distroverpkg=redhat-release | + | [base] |
− | + | name=Red Hat Linux $releasever - $basearch - Base | |
− | tolerant=1 | + | ba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/os/ |
− | + | gpgcheck=1 | |
− | exactarch=1 | + | |
− | + | [updates] | |
− | exclude=kernel* | + | name=Red Hat Linux $releasever - $basearch - updates |
− | + | ba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/updates/ | |
− | + | gpgcheck=1 | |
− | [base] | + | |
− | + | ||
− | name=Red Hat Linux $releasever - $basearch - Base | + | |
− | + | ||
− | ba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/os/ | + | |
− | + | ||
− | gpgcheck=1 | + | |
− | + | ||
− | + | ||
− | [updates] | + | |
− | + | ||
− | name=Red Hat Linux $releasever - $basearch - updates | + | |
− | + | ||
− | ba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/updates/ | + | |
− | + | ||
− | gpgcheck=1 | + | |
− | + | ||
− | + | ||
== Fedora-Legacy-gpg-Schlüssel zum Root-Schlüsselring laden == | == Fedora-Legacy-gpg-Schlüssel zum Root-Schlüsselring laden == | ||
* Key von http://www.fedoralegacy.org/FEDORA-LEGACY-GPG-KEY laden | * Key von http://www.fedoralegacy.org/FEDORA-LEGACY-GPG-KEY laden | ||
− | + | gpg --import fedora-legacy-gpg-key.asc | |
− | gpg --import fedora-legacy-gpg-key.asc | + | |
== System updaten == | == System updaten == | ||
− | + | yum update | |
− | yum update | + | |
Beim ersten Mal dauert es eine Weile, da erstmal sämtliche verfügbaren Informationen über alle installierten und verfügbaren Pakete gesammelt werden müssen. | Beim ersten Mal dauert es eine Weile, da erstmal sämtliche verfügbaren Informationen über alle installierten und verfügbaren Pakete gesammelt werden müssen. | ||
− | |||
== yum automatisieren == | == yum automatisieren == | ||
Das automatischen Aktualisieren des Systemes via cron-Job kann mit folgenden Kommandos erreicht werden: | Das automatischen Aktualisieren des Systemes via cron-Job kann mit folgenden Kommandos erreicht werden: | ||
− | + | chkconfig yum on | |
− | chkconfig yum on | + | service yum start |
− | + | ||
− | service yum start | + | |
− | + | ||
Danach sollte ein nächtlicher cron-Job eingestellt sein. (habe ich aber noch nicht probiert...) | Danach sollte ein nächtlicher cron-Job eingestellt sein. (habe ich aber noch nicht probiert...) | ||
+ | == weitere yum-Kommandos == | ||
− | + | man yum | |
− | + | ||
− | man yum | + |
Aktuelle Version vom 18. Oktober 2005, 15:36 Uhr
yum stammt eigentlich aus der Ferdora-Distribution, kann aber auch zur Aktualisierung einer RedHat-Installation verwendet werden. In der Folge ist eine Kurzanleitung für RedHat zu finden. Eine ausführliche Dokumentation ist unter http://www.fedoralegacy.org (auch für andere RedHat-Versionen) zu finden.
Alle im weiteren beschriebenen Kommandos/Aktionen sind unter Root durchzuführen.
Inhaltsverzeichnis |
[Bearbeiten] Vorbereitungen
- aktuelles gnupg installieren
rpm -Uvh http://download.fedoralegacy.org/redhat/9/updates/i386/gnupg-1.2.1-9.i386.rpm
- yum installieren
rpm -ivh http://download.fedora.us/fedora/redhat/9/i386/RPMS.stable/yum-2.0.3-0.fdr.1.rh90.noarch.rpm
[Bearbeiten] yum konfigurieren
In /etc/yum.conf sollte stehen:
[main] cachedir=/var/cache/yum debuglevel=2 logfile=/var/log/yum.log pkgpolicy=newest distroverpkg=redhat-release tolerant=1 exactarch=1 exclude=kernel* [base] name=Red Hat Linux $releasever - $basearch - Base ba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/os/ gpgcheck=1 [updates] name=Red Hat Linux $releasever - $basearch - updates baseurl=http://download.fedora.us/fedora/redhat/$releasever/$basearch/yum/updates/ gpgcheck=1
[Bearbeiten] Fedora-Legacy-gpg-Schlüssel zum Root-Schlüsselring laden
- Key von http://www.fedoralegacy.org/FEDORA-LEGACY-GPG-KEY laden
gpg --import fedora-legacy-gpg-key.asc
[Bearbeiten] System updaten
yum update
Beim ersten Mal dauert es eine Weile, da erstmal sämtliche verfügbaren Informationen über alle installierten und verfügbaren Pakete gesammelt werden müssen.
[Bearbeiten] yum automatisieren
Das automatischen Aktualisieren des Systemes via cron-Job kann mit folgenden Kommandos erreicht werden:
chkconfig yum on service yum start
Danach sollte ein nächtlicher cron-Job eingestellt sein. (habe ich aber noch nicht probiert...)
[Bearbeiten] weitere yum-Kommandos
man yum